Fuel Pump Control Circuit
DESCRIPTION
When the engine is cranked, the starter relay drive signal from the ignition switch is input into the STA terminal of the ECM, and the NE signal generated by the crankshaft position sensor is also input into the NE+ terminal. Thus, the ECM interprets that the engine is being cranked, and turns transistor Tr1 in the ECM internal circuit ON. The current flows to the C/OPN (Circuit Opening) relay by turning Tr1 ON. Then, the fuel pump operates.
While the NE signal is input into the ECM, and the engine is running, the ECM turns Tr1 on continuously.

9. READ VALUE USING TECHSTREAM (ENGINE SPD)
(a) Connect the Techstream to the DLC3.
(b) Turn the ignition switch to ON.
(c) Turn the Techstream on.
(d) Enter the following menus: Powertrain / Engine and ECT / Data List / All Data / Engine Speed.
(e) Read the values displayed on the Techstream while cranking.
OK:
Values are displayed continuously.
NG -- REPAIR OR REPLACE CRANKSHAFT POSITION SENSOR CIRCUIT
OK -- REPLACE ECM
